今、話題のものづくりゲーム「Minecraft(マインクラフト)」を使ってプログラミングが学習できる教育プログラムです。Minecraftの世界の中でコンピュータへの命令をプログラミングすることで、洞窟を掘る、建物を建てる、等の動作を自動で行わせるような開発を学習することができます。ゲームの中で楽しくプログラミングの基本が学べるよう設計されたコースです。PC操作が不安な方も、初心者も大歓迎!スキルに合わせた「学び」がここにある!
対象:小学4年生〜高校3年生
Scratchは、世界的に有名なアメリカのマサチューセッツ工科大学メディアラボが開発した、子供向けのプログラミング学習開発環境です。 プログラミングをするためには英語が必要、うちの子にはまだ早いかも・・・そういった方にオススメのコースです。 Scratchを使うと、日本語のブロックを動かすことで簡単なゲームを作りながらプログラミングを学習することができます。 それゆえに、コードを直接書くプログラミング学習が難しいお子さんでも、直感的に操作を行うことができます。 もちろん、Scratchを利用した研究も多数行われており、その多くで学習効果が高いという結果が出ています。 Scratchコースは基礎的な学習コースで、プログラミングの基本的な流れを学びます。
スマートフォンゲーム・アプリ開発で40%以上の会社が使用している、ゲームエンジンUnityを使って、スマートフォン向けのアプリケーションを開発するコースです。自分だけのオリジナル人工知能(AI)を作成しながら、Unityの使い方、プログラミング技術の習得を目指します。本格的な学習コースで、アプリ甲子園などのコンテスト入賞を目指します。
WEBページを作るための最も基本的な言語がHTMLです。そして、WEBページにボタンを押したときの反応などの動きを付けるために 使われている言語がJavaScriptです。本コースでは、JavaScriptに機能を追加して簡単にゲームを作られるようにしたenchant.jsをマスターします。 WEBページがそのまま画面になるのでenchant.jsを使えばパソコンだけでなくスマートフォンでも動作するゲームを作ることができ、準備も簡単です。 enchant.jsを使って様々なゲームを作りながら、プログラミングの技術を学んでいきます。 みんなの知っているようなアクションゲームやパズルゲームから、高度な迷路の解法探索AIまで、楽しみながらどんどん作って学んでいきましょう。